open
https://gitlab.synchro.net/main/sbbs/-/issues/715
Got an email about my letsencrypt certs expiring, turns out letsyncrypt.js is failing to run. I have tried to reset the .ini file to standard (without key-id & State) to no avail.
```plaintext
nick ➜ /sbbs/ctrl $ jsexec letsyncrypt.js
JSexec v3.20a-Linux master/e230bd350 - Execute Synchronet JavaScript Module Compiled Jan 8 2024 10:03:03 with GCC 11.4.0Loading configuration files from /sbbs/ctrl
JavaScript-C 1.8.5 2011-03-31
JavaScript: Creating runtime: 8388608 bytesReading script from /sbbs/exec/letsyncrypt.js
/sbbs/exec/letsyncrypt.js compiled in 0.00 seconds
!JavaScript : uncaught exception: Authorization failed...
https://acme-v02.api.letsencrypt.org/acme/authz-v3/<redacted>
/sbbs/exec/letsyncrypt.js executed in 4.10 seconds
!Module (letsyncrypt.js) set exit_code: 1JavaScript: Destroying context JavaScript: Destroying runtimeReturning error code: 1
```
--- SBBSecho 3.20-Linux
*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)